- Players/clients: VLC, Kodi, TiviMate, IPTV Smarters, Plex, Jellyfin.
- DVR/tuner hardware: HDHomeRun, Tablo, SiliconDust tuners.
- FAST services: Pluto TV, Tubi, Xumo, Samsung TV Plus.
- Major services: YouTube TV, Hulu + Live TV, Sling, fuboTV, DirecTV Stream.
- Utilities: XMLTV, WebGrab+Plus (for guide scraping), M3U editors.
